Transaction bb62a39bb1fa671ba13f55829800a82ad66aed5ac13f175ee7d3957f79e79010
1 Input
1 Output
-
bb62a39bb1fa671ba13f55829800a82ad66aed5ac13f175ee7d3957f79e79010:0
- value
- 859468
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88168c1a769be9a650e8e3b001ae29040c2c886b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DQZuhgHPjpFkXdipufXAHE2HfvRBF6wJW